Merge I2C command handler into main #18
@ -142,9 +142,15 @@ uint8_t route_command(int pos) {
|
|||||||
case READ_TERMPERATURE:
|
case READ_TERMPERATURE:
|
||||||
return READ_TERMPERATURE;
|
return READ_TERMPERATURE;
|
||||||
case READ_FAN_SPEED:
|
case READ_FAN_SPEED:
|
||||||
return READ_FAN_SPEED;
|
if (context.fan == FAN1) {
|
||||||
|
return fan1_history[0];
|
||||||
|
} else if (context.fan == FAN2) {
|
||||||
|
return fan2_history[0];
|
||||||
|
} else {
|
||||||
|
return 0;
|
||||||
|
}
|
||||||
|
break;
|
||||||
case READ_BULK_FAN_SPEED:
|
case READ_BULK_FAN_SPEED:
|
||||||
{
|
|
||||||
if (context.fan == FAN1) {
|
if (context.fan == FAN1) {
|
||||||
return fan1_history[pos];
|
return fan1_history[pos];
|
||||||
} else if (context.fan == FAN2) {
|
} else if (context.fan == FAN2) {
|
||||||
@ -152,7 +158,7 @@ uint8_t route_command(int pos) {
|
|||||||
} else {
|
} else {
|
||||||
return 0;
|
return 0;
|
||||||
}
|
}
|
||||||
}
|
break;
|
||||||
case UNKNOWN_COMMAND:
|
case UNKNOWN_COMMAND:
|
||||||
default:
|
default:
|
||||||
return 0xFF;
|
return 0xFF;
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user